* {
margin: 0;
padding: 0;
}
body {
color:#999999;
font-family: 'verdana','ms gothic';
font-size: 10px;
background-image: url('http://sa-dolce.img.jugem.jp/20080104_15818.gif');
background-position: center top;
}
table,tr,td {
color:#999999;
font-family: 'verdana','ms gothic';
font-size: 10px;
}

a {color: #FF9900; text-decoration:none;}
a:link {color: #FF9900; text-decoration:none;}
a:visited {color: #FF9900; text-decoration:none;}
a:active {color: #FF9900; text-decoration:none;}
a:hover {color:#FF9900;text-decoration: underline;}



.entry_left
 {width:162px;height:485px;
background-image: url('http://sa-dolce.img.jugem.jp/20080104_15815.gif');
background-repeat: no-repeat;
background-position: center center;}

.entry_right {
text-align: left;text-valign:top;
width: 399px;height: 485px;
background-image: url('http://sa-dolce.img.jugem.jp/20080104_15816.gif');
background-repeat: no-repeat;
background-position: center center;
}
.entry_body
 {width:322px;height:276px;overflow:auto;
text-align:left;text-valign:top;
margin-left:2px; background-color:#FFD20B;}

.entry_title
 {color:#ffffff;font-size:12px;border-bottom: 1px dotted #FF9900;
letter-spacing: 2px;font-family:'ms gothic';
margin-bottom:5px; text-align:left;text-align:left;}

.entry
 {color:#ffffff;font-size:10px;text-align:left;
line-height: 160%;letter-spacing: 1px;font-family:'verdana','ms pgothic'}

.entry_navi
 {color:#ffffff;border-bottom: 1px dotted #FF9900; font-size:10px;
letter-spacing: 1px;margin-bottom:15px;text-align:right;}

.site_title {font-size: 22px; color: #FF9900; text-decoration:none;font-family:'Comic Sans MS';}
.site_title a {font-size: 22px; color: #FF9900; text-decoration:none;}
.site_title a:link {font-size: 22px; color: #FF9900; text-decoration:none;}
.site_title a:visited {font-size: 22px; color: #FF9900; text-decoration:none;}
.site_title a:active {font-size: 22px; color: #FF9900; text-decoration:none;}
.site_title a:hover {font-size: 22px;color:#FFD20B;text-decoration: underline; }
.description
 {font-size:10px;letter-spacing: 1px;line-height:130%;
margin-bottom:10px;color:#999999;font-family:'verdana','ms gothic';}

.MENU {
visibility: hidden;
z-index: 999;
position: absolute;
width:180px;
margin-top:5px;
padding-top:5px;
background: #FFD20B;
border: 1px #FF9900 dotted;}

.list_title {font-size:14px;color:#FF9900;font-family:'Comic Sans MS';
letter-spacing: 1px;}
.list {font-size:10px;color:#333366;font-family:'verdana';
letter-spacing: 1px;}

.list a {color: #FF9900; text-decoration:none;}
.list a:link {color: #FF9900; text-decoration:none;}
.list a:visited {color: #FF9900; text-decoration:none;}
.list a:active {color: #FF9900; text-decoration:none;}
.list a:hover {color:#FFD20B;text-decoration: underline;}

ul {list-style-type: none;line-height:120%;margin-left:5px;
font-family:'verdana';font-size:10px;}
li {margin-bottom:1px;list-style-type: none;line-height:120%;
font-family:'verdana';font-size:10px;}

input,textarea
 {color: #333366;font-size :10px;border:1px #FF9900 dotted;
background-color:#FFD20B;padding: 1px;font-family:'verdana';
letter-spacing: 1px;}
.comment_title
 {color:#333366;font-size:10px;
border-bottom: 1px dotted #FF9900;letter-spacing: 1px;
margin-bottom:15px;margin-top:15px;
font-family:'Comic Sans MS','ms pgothic';text-align:left;}
.comment_name
 {color:#333366;font-size:10px;margin-bottom:5px;margin-top:15px
letter-spacing: 3px;font-family:'ms gothic','ms pgothic';text-align:left;}
.commnet_form
 {color:#333366;font-family:'Comic Sans MS';font-size:10px;
letter-spacing: 1px;text-align:right;}

br { letter-spacing: normal}
hr {border:1px #FF9900 dotted;}
html {
scrollbar-base-color: #FFD20B;
scrollbar-face-color: #FFD20B;
scrollbar-track-color: #FFD20B;
scrollbar-arrow-color: #FF9900;
scrollbar-3dlight-color: #FFD20B;
scrollbar-highlight-color: #FFD20B;
scrollbar-shadow-color: #FFD20B;
scrollbar-darkshadow-color: #FFD20B;
}

.ad {text-align:right;margin:5px;}

.calendar
 {color:#999999;font-size:10px;font-family:'Comic Sans MS';
margin:0px auto;}
.calendar_month
 {font-family: "Comic Sans MS";margin-bottom: 10px;
 font-size: 10px;color: #999999;}
.weekday
 {width: 25px;height: 20px;padding: 0px;text-align:center;
font-size: 10px;color: #FF9900;}
.cell
 {width: 25px;height: 20px;padding: 0px;
text-align:center;font-size: 10px;color: #999999;background:#ffffff;}

.cell a {color: #999999;text-decoration: none; font-weight:bolder;}
.cell a:link {color: #FF9900;text-decoration: none;}
.cell a:visited {color: #FF9900;text-decoration: none;}
.cell a:active {color: #FF9900;text-decoration: none;}
.cell a:hover {color: #FFD20B;text-decoration: none;}
.rsstc   { font-size: 12px; background-color: #ffcc00; margin: 0; padding: 0 }
.rsstc a { color: #0000ff;}
.rsstc em  { font-style: normal; font-weight: bold; margin-left: 10px; padding: 0 }
.rsstc ul   { background-color: #fdfdfd; margin: 0; padding: 0 ;border: solid 2px #ffcc00 }
.rsstc li   { list-style-type: none; padding-top: 1px; padding-bottom: 1px; padding-left: 5px; border-bottom: 1px dashed #ffcc00 }